Analyze two reasons why the power of the federal bureaucracy has expanded

The power of the federal bureaucracy expanded greatly in the 1930s out of the fear of scarcity that the Great Depression produced. It then expanded greatly once more in the early 2000s as the National Security Apparatus exponentially grew to meet the threat of terrorism. In both instances, America was afraid so the federal government grew.
